A small, pleasant hotel right in the heart of Amsterdam, just around the corner from the Rijksmuseum. The hotel is run with a lot of love. The staff and owners are extremely polite. I was at an event in the Melkweg and the check-out time of 12 noon was very convenient. For a short stay of one or two nights, I would book this hotel again. Wonderful view of the canal. Restaurants, supermarkets, and several kiosks open 24/7 are all just around the corner. The price was okay for the location.

Here are a few tips for other travelers: 1. The stairs are very steep and there is no elevator. 2. The rooms are really small, so a longer stay is almost impossible because you can't really store your belongings anywhere. 3. The hotel only has single glazing, which means that noise from outside cannot really be kept out. 4. There is no air conditioning—I knew this beforehand and it is also stated in the description. 5. The hotel is located directly in the flight path of the airport. With the windows open, you feel like you are staying at an airport—a plane flies past every 2–3 minutes. Again, these are just tips for future guests; none of these points bothered me - and I would book the hotel again for a short trip!!!

What's the check-in and check-out schedule at Boutique Hotel View?

Guests at Boutique Hotel View can check in between 14:00 and 22:00. Check-out time is set for 12:00.

What's the nightly rate at Boutique Hotel View?

Starting rates at Boutique Hotel View begin from $128. However, prices can vary based on room type and selected dates. Please enter your dates for accurate pricing.
